网络运维监控系统如何支持大数据分析?
随着互联网技术的飞速发展,大数据时代已经到来。在众多领域,大数据分析发挥着越来越重要的作用。而在网络运维领域,如何利用大数据分析提高运维效率,成为了一个亟待解决的问题。本文将探讨网络运维监控系统如何支持大数据分析,以期为相关从业者提供有益的参考。
一、网络运维监控系统概述
网络运维监控系统是用于实时监控网络设备、系统性能、网络安全等方面的工具。它能够及时发现网络故障,保障网络稳定运行。在传统的网络运维管理中,运维人员需要花费大量时间进行数据收集、分析,以了解网络运行状况。而随着大数据技术的应用,网络运维监控系统逐渐向智能化、自动化方向发展。
二、大数据分析在网络运维监控系统中的应用
- 数据采集与整合
大数据分析的第一步是数据采集与整合。网络运维监控系统通过收集网络设备、系统性能、网络安全等数据,为后续分析提供基础。以下是几种常见的数据采集方式:
- 网络流量数据:通过分析网络流量数据,可以了解网络带宽使用情况、数据传输速率等,从而发现潜在的网络瓶颈。
- 设备性能数据:收集网络设备、服务器等设备的CPU、内存、磁盘等性能数据,可以实时监控设备运行状态,预防故障发生。
- 安全事件数据:分析安全事件数据,有助于发现网络攻击、恶意软件等安全威胁,提高网络安全防护能力。
- 数据预处理与存储
数据预处理是大数据分析过程中的重要环节。它包括数据清洗、数据转换、数据归一化等操作,以确保数据的准确性和一致性。数据存储则是将预处理后的数据存储在合适的存储系统中,以便后续分析。
- 数据挖掘与分析
数据挖掘是大数据分析的核心环节,通过挖掘数据中的规律和关联,为运维人员提供决策支持。以下是一些常见的网络运维监控系统中的数据挖掘与分析方法:
- 故障预测:通过分析历史故障数据,建立故障预测模型,提前发现潜在故障,降低故障发生概率。
- 性能优化:分析网络设备、系统性能数据,找出性能瓶颈,提出优化方案,提高网络运行效率。
- 安全分析:分析安全事件数据,发现安全威胁,制定相应的安全策略。
- 可视化展示
可视化展示是将分析结果以图表、图形等形式直观地呈现给运维人员,方便他们快速了解网络运行状况。以下是一些常见的可视化展示方式:
- 实时监控图表:展示网络流量、设备性能、安全事件等实时数据。
- 历史趋势图:展示网络运行状况的历史趋势,帮助运维人员了解网络运行规律。
- 故障分析报告:展示故障原因、影响范围、处理措施等信息。
三、案例分析
以某大型企业为例,其网络运维监控系统采用了大数据分析技术,实现了以下效果:
- 故障预测:通过分析历史故障数据,系统提前预测了潜在故障,避免了实际故障发生,降低了企业损失。
- 性能优化:系统分析了网络设备、系统性能数据,提出了优化方案,提高了网络运行效率,降低了运维成本。
- 安全防护:系统分析了安全事件数据,发现了安全威胁,制定了相应的安全策略,保障了企业网络安全。
四、总结
网络运维监控系统与大数据分析的结合,为网络运维管理提供了有力支持。通过数据采集、预处理、挖掘与分析,运维人员可以实时了解网络运行状况,及时发现故障,提高网络运行效率。未来,随着大数据技术的不断发展,网络运维监控系统将更加智能化、自动化,为网络运维管理带来更多可能性。
猜你喜欢:SkyWalking